As Director of AI - Chief Data Office you will be part of the leadership team within the Chief Data Office and responsible for overseeing Artificial Intelligence initiatives. This will include establishing frameworks and processes for Data-centric AI use cases on the AI & data platforms (e.g. machine learning deployment) supporting data led use cases, as well as enhancing our AI data capabilities, enabling AI driven decision-making using data , and fostering a culture of innovation within the organisation. You will develop and execute a comprehensive AI strategy aligned with the CDO, the organisations business objectives and the CIO operating model. You will be identifying and pursuing innovative projects that leverage data and AI to drive business value. 


Your role will drive experimentation through prototypes and proof of concepts by providing sandbox environments, tooling advisory, and accelerators for AI solutions. You will drive Intact Insurance UK Limited to be the leading edge through researching and implementing the latest trends and advancements in data science and AI, whilst integrating relevant technologies into the lab's projects. As part of your role, you will design, support the development of, and oversee the deployment of ML models. 


You will define and manage Data-centric AI frameworks for the organisation, ensuring all data and associated AI practices comply with relevant regulations, ethical standards, and internal policies, this includes enabling analytical & data teams by establishing and managing AI governance on the Data/AI platform. Your role will establish an AI Data Centric CoE, working alongside the central AI governance function to bring together Data, technology, risk to support data led use cases to achieve the groups AI ambitions and goals, partnering with our parent company to accelerate our journey. You will build, mentor and lead a high-performing team of data scientists and ML engineers, whilst providing senior leaders appropriate recommendations and reporting on AI initiatives and usage at RSA.

You will have an extensive background in Data Science, Machine Learning, and AI with an understanding of the insurance business, including commercial and specialty lines. You will have an excellent understanding of responsible AI, Data Architecture, Machine Learning, and analytics frameworks with a passion for keeping up to date with the latest developments in Data and AI. An excellent understanding of Azure, Databricks, and ML Platforms and using and rolling out LLM models in an enterprise will be required for your role. 


You will have extensive experience with tools such as TensorFlow, PyTorch, Scikit-learn and knowledge of data engineering and cloud platforms. You will be an experienced leader, with excellent communication skills and the ability to influence and engage stakeholders at all levels, explaining complex AI concepts to non-technical stakeholders. An excellent knowledge of compliance frameworks and ethical AI guidelines will be required for your role

GAIN (Group for Autism, Insurance, Investment and Neurodiversity 

Our mission is simple: to spark an industry-owned and industry-led radical improvement in the employment prospects of neurodivergent people in insurance, investment and related areas of financial services.

To help achieve this, we have created a community hub of neurodivergent individuals, corporates, partners and researchers, all working together to create inclusive and diverse workplaces across our industry.
